This is about the half post on small houses. These are early houses that were too small to have a regular round "firecracker" technology fence post - unless one used a lady finger size. But they didn't. I have had these before but they are sort of uncommon. Likely because the makers need to have a ready source of reeds of some sort. What I used are some sunflower stalks that came from a droughty field and were small and stunted but the diameters of the ones I picked up were right. In the photos below you can see the house with all three posts I had to replace. The two front half posts were much smaller than the one on the side. Unfortunately a reed would work better as the inside of the sunflower stocks is soft and pithy but I made them work anyway as it isn't a structural issue and doesn't show. Notice I used a plastic Tupperware cutting board as my work service and a serrated kitchen knife to saw the piece of the stalks. I also used a box cutter type knife to split the post into. Snick snack and done. Quick easy and fills the bill. If anyone has any questions about this please write. I think the photos are pretty self explanatory.
